And Marshall, what his computer is referring to is the LAN port on the side of the computer, this is how he would connect to the internet, if not for wireless, much how you connect to the internet through a LAN port as well. The link layer of the internet is one of the most confusing and ad-hoc.
And Ryan, what your computer is saying is that you have a 100BASE-T ethernet port on your computer and if plugged in the max signal rate is 100 Mbps. Your wireless will naturally be lower because wireless rates don't get that high, as well as most wireless cards in laptops throttle down the speed to conserve power and generate less heat when you're not using all the bandwidth. This is fine because internet speeds will rarely achieve more than 10 Mbps consistent throughput, which is pretty fast.
